blob: 590cf78c63dcec4de58919e2c1db2ddfc1b04389 [file] [log] [blame]
Akron7636edf2025-11-04 12:44:53 +01001@use "../util";
2@use "../base/colors";
3@use "../base/icons";
4@use "../base/lengths";
5@use "../base/mixins";
Akron7e5afce2020-08-25 15:50:19 +02006
7/**
8 * Styles for OAuth management form.
9 */
10
Akron0f1b93b2020-03-17 11:37:19 +010011ul.client-list {
12 padding-left: 1.5em;
Akron7e5afce2020-08-25 15:50:19 +020013
Akron1a9d5be2020-03-19 17:28:33 +010014 li.client {
Akron0f1b93b2020-03-17 11:37:19 +010015 list-style-type: none;
Akronb6b156e2022-03-31 14:57:49 +020016 margin-bottom: 1.5em;
Akron7e5afce2020-08-25 15:50:19 +020017
18 span.client-name::before {
19 margin-left: -1.5em;
Akron0f1b93b2020-03-17 11:37:19 +010020 }
Akron7e5afce2020-08-25 15:50:19 +020021
Akronb6b156e2022-03-31 14:57:49 +020022 p.client-desc, p.client-url {
23 font-weight: normal;
24 font-size: 80%;
25 margin-top: .2em;
26 margin-bottom: .2em;
Akron0f1b93b2020-03-17 11:37:19 +010027 }
28 }
Akron9ffb4a32021-06-08 16:11:21 +020029
Akron5f756412021-06-18 11:35:58 +020030 br {
31 display: block;
32 margin: 3pt 0;
Akron9ffb4a32021-06-08 16:11:21 +020033 }
Akron1a9d5be2020-03-19 17:28:33 +010034}
35
36span.client-name {
Akron7e5afce2020-08-25 15:50:19 +020037 font-weight: bold;
38
Akron1a9d5be2020-03-19 17:28:33 +010039 &::before {
Akron7636edf2025-11-04 12:44:53 +010040 @include mixins.icon-font;
Akron7e5afce2020-08-25 15:50:19 +020041 display: inline-block;
42 width: 1.5em;
Akron7636edf2025-11-04 12:44:53 +010043 content: icons.$fa-client;
44 color: colors.$ids-blue-1;
Akron1a9d5be2020-03-19 17:28:33 +010045 font-size: 100%;
46 }
Akron9ffb4a32021-06-08 16:11:21 +020047}
48
Akronb45300f2022-04-28 14:03:53 +020049.client-type-confidential::after {
Akron7636edf2025-11-04 12:44:53 +010050 @include mixins.icon-font;
Akronb45300f2022-04-28 14:03:53 +020051 margin-left: .3em;
52 display: inline-block;
53 width: 1.5em;
54 font-size: 70%;
Akron3b2b29e2025-06-24 10:55:30 +020055 // line-height: top;
Akronb45300f2022-04-28 14:03:53 +020056 vertical-align: text-top;
57}
58
59.client-type-confidential::after {
Akron7636edf2025-11-04 12:44:53 +010060 content: icons.$fa-confidential;
61 color: colors.$ids-blue-1;
Akronb45300f2022-04-28 14:03:53 +020062}
63
Akron6b75d122022-05-12 17:39:05 +020064#client_source {
65 white-space: pre;
Akron7636edf2025-11-04 12:44:53 +010066 border-radius: lengths.$standard-border-radius;
67 border-color: colors.$ids-grey-2;
Akron6b75d122022-05-12 17:39:05 +020068 border-style: solid;
Akron7636edf2025-11-04 12:44:53 +010069 background-color: colors.$light-orange;
Akron6b75d122022-05-12 17:39:05 +020070}
71
Akron9ffb4a32021-06-08 16:11:21 +020072li.token {
73 list-style-type: none;
74}
75
76
77label[for=token] {
78 font-weight: bold;
79
80 &::before {
Akron7636edf2025-11-04 12:44:53 +010081 @include mixins.icon-font;
Akron9ffb4a32021-06-08 16:11:21 +020082 font-feature-settings: "ss01" on;
83 margin-left: -1.5em;
84 display: inline-block;
85 width: 1.5em;
Akron7636edf2025-11-04 12:44:53 +010086 content: icons.$fa-token;
87 color: colors.$ids-blue-1 !important;
Akron9ffb4a32021-06-08 16:11:21 +020088 font-size: 100%;
89 font-weight: 900;
90 }
91}